Acquaint Your Child With the Dental Office
Start by taking your youngster to the dental workplace before their first see, so they can end up being aware of the environments and really feel even more at ease. This step is important in aiding to decrease any anxiousness or fear your child may have about going to the dental professional.
Below are a couple of ways to familiarize your kid with the dental office:
- ** Arrange a quick excursion **: Call the oral office and ask if you can bring your child for a brief trip. This will certainly allow them to see the waiting area, therapy rooms, and fulfill the friendly staff.
- ** Role-play at home **: Make believe to be the dental practitioner and have your kid sit in a chair while you analyze their teeth. This will help them recognize what to anticipate throughout their real go to.
- ** Check out publications or enjoy video clips **: Search for kids's publications or videos that describe what happens at the dental practitioner. This can aid your child feel a lot more comfortable and prepared.
Equip Your Child With Healthy Oral Behaviors
Establishing healthy and balanced dental practices is vital for your youngster's dental wellness and overall wellness. By teaching your youngster great dental habits from an early age, you can aid stop dental caries, gum tissue condition, and other dental health and wellness problems.
Start by educating them the importance of brushing their teeth two times a day, utilizing a soft-bristled toothbrush and fluoride toothpaste. Program them the proper brushing technique, seeing to it they clean all surfaces of their teeth and gum tissues.
Urge them to floss daily to get rid of plaque and food bits from in between their teeth.
Restriction their consumption of sweet treats and drinks, as these can add to tooth decay.
Lastly, schedule routine dental examinations for your kid to preserve their dental health and wellness and attend to any type of issues early.
